Bridge No. 28 in Pursat province – the tallest in Cambodia at 90 meters high and 530 meters long – has achieved 93% completion and is scheduled to be put into temporary use on March 18, 2025.
On Sunday morning, February 2, 2025, His Excellency Peng Purna, Minister of Public Works and Transport, visited to inspect the progress of the construction of National Road No. 10 (formerly National Road 1551).
This bridge is part of the National Road 10 construction project.
The center of the bridge is located at kilometer 128+905 and crosses the Stung Russey Chrum valley with a 90-degree intersection angle.
The upper structure has a “T” type beam, the eastern part has 4 beams, the middle part is a cable-stayed box beam with 3 beams, and the western part is a “T” type beam with 5 beams.
